Sliding doors that aren't smooth usually need attention to their rollers or track. Pros often clean and lubricate the track and rollers first. If they're damaged or worn out, they'll need to be replaced. Getting your door back on track is usually straightforward for an experienced repair specialist.
Absolutely. Roller replacement is a very common sliding glass door repair. Worn or broken rollers are a primary reason why doors become difficult to slide. A skilled technician can usually replace these relatively quickly to restore smooth operation to your door.
If your sliding glass door has come off its track, it often involves carefully lifting and maneuvering the door. Sometimes the track itself might be bent or damaged, requiring repair. A professional can assess if the track needs straightening or if the door just needs to be properly re-seated.
